Kemin Industries launched its global “61 Since ’61” themed anniversary celebration to commemorate 61 years since its founding in 1961.

Initially created to provide feed flavors, crop preservatives and antioxidants to Midwest farmers, Kemin’s business has greatly expanded since 1961. Today, Kemin operates in more than 90 countries and applies its technologies and expertise in molecular science across a variety of industries to offer products with functional benefits that enhance the health and safety of people, pets, production animals, plants, and the planet. Six decades later, Kemin remains focused on transforming the quality of life.

With more than USD 1 billion in annual sales, the multinational, family-owned-and-operated company is headquartered in Des Moines, Iowa, U.S. on the site of the old wool barn where Kemin’s co-founder, R.W. Nelson, created the company’s first products. The site is now part of a 70-acre campus that is home to Kemin’s USD 30 million global headquarters, built for future expansion and additional research facilities.

From an old wool barn to global company

Kemin founders, R.W. and Mary Nelson, had yet to realize the trajectory of Kemin and its future impact on the world when they launched the company in 1961. Using their savings of USD 10,000, R.W. manufactured two product lines in his father’s old wool barn in Des Moines, and Mary managed the business and financial administration from the family’s living room, all while caring for their five children under the age of seven.

With an inventive spirit, the Nelsons successfully grew their business, initially named “Chemical Industries, Inc.”, beyond agriculture and the Midwest to currently serving customers in more than 120 countries, on six continents, and with more than 3,000 global employees. 

Since founding Kemin, R.W. and Mary have ensured servant leadership and a deep commitment to bettering communities remain central to the company and their family. Their steadfastness has guided Kemin to partner with local and global nonprofit organizations in the areas of science and general education, affordable housing and food security, sustainability, and the creation of vibrant communities.

The third generation of Nelson family members has now started to take on leadership roles within the business, continuing their grandparents’ legacy and philosophy of service. Now in their mid-90s, both R.W. and Mary remain engaged with the company.
